Urea ammonium sulphate-based composition and method for the manufacture thereof
The invention relates to a homogeneous, solid, particulate, urea ammonium sulphate (UAS)-based composition comprising urea ammonium sulphate, a urease inhibitor of the type phosphoric triamide and magnesium sulphate, characterized in that the UAS-based composition comprises 0.02 to 1 weight % of magnesium sulphate, 0.0001 to 1 weight % of the urease inhibitor and about 5 to about 30 weight % of ammonium sulphate. The composition according to the invention has improved properties for reducing ammonia loss by urease activity in the soil and is in particular suitable as a fertilizer. The invention further relates to a method for the manufacture of a homogeneous, solid, particulate urea ammonium sulphate-based composition comprising urea, ammonium sulphate and a urease inhibitor of the type phosphoric triamide, in particular N-(n-butyl) thiophosphoric triamide (nBTPT), as well as to a composition of kit of parts comprising an amount of a) magnesium sulphate; b) a urease inhibitor of the type phosphoric triamide, preferably N-(n-butyl) thiophosphoric triamide (nBTPT); c) optionally, an alkaline or alkaline-forming compound, selected from the group of calcium oxide, zinc oxide, magnesium oxide, calcium carbonate, and mixtures thereof, and d) optionally, one or more anti-caking and/or moisture-repellent and/or anti-dust compounds.
PALM-BASED ANIMAL FEED
Animal feed formed with a base of palm fronds and combined with palm fruit, such as dates, is a sustainable and affordable feed product that can be developed in hot climates. Palm fronds with a desired moisture content are shredded, chopped, and/or ground, and mixed with palm fruit. Additives such as urea can increase the nutritional content. Feeds with palm fronds, palm fruit, and/or additives can serve as a base feed for other components. Palm fronds can also serve as a base feed for other components. Animal feeds with a variety of bases can have palm fruit added. Animal feeds with a variety of bases, including palm fronds, can include a variety of other components added.

Urea-based composition comprising elemental sulphur and method for the manufacture thereof
The invention relates to a particulate urea-based composition comprising elemental sulphur and a urease inhibitor of the type phosphoric triamide, wherein the urea-based composition comprising elemental sulphur is further characterized in that it comprises a magnesium sulphate. The composition according to the invention has improved properties for reducing ammonia loss by urease activity in the soil and is in particular suitable as a fertilizer. The invention further relates to a method for the manufacture of a particulate urea-based composition comprising urea, elemental sulphur and a urease inhibitor of the type phosphoric triamide, in particular N-(n-butyl) thiophosphoric triamide (nBTPT), as well as to a composition of kit of parts comprising a magnesium sulphate.

Means for protecting methionine hydroxy analog from rumen degradation
Chemically modified methionine hydroxy analogs that are protected from degradation by rumen microorganisms. The chemically modified compounds comprise methionine hydroxy analog chemically linked to a fatty acid having at least 12 carbon atoms. Methods for increasing rumen bypass of methionine hydroxy analog and/or providing methionine hydroxy analog to a ruminant's small intestine for absorption, wherein the methods comprise administering to the ruminant a chemically modified methionine hydroxy analog as defined above.

FEED SUPPLEMENT AND EXTRACT
A method of making a product from grass that includes carrying out steps A to D in order, where: Step A is cutting the grass to a length of between 35 mm to 150 mm resulting in cut grass with at least 90% leaf and little to no dead plant material; Step B is drying of the cut grass to produce dry grass; Step C is collecting and transferring the dry grass to at least one first container, removing excess air and then sealing the at least one first container; and Step D is aging the dry grass in the at least one first containers in a cool dark place for a primary period of time to produce a dry product.
COMPOSITIONS FOR ADMINISTRATION TO ANIMALS TO INCREASE GUT NON-PROTEIN NITROGEN LEVELS
The present invention is concerned with increasing protein intake in a ruminant animal by supplementing the diet of the ruminant animal with urea phosphate. There can also be supplementation with a water soluble sulfur-containing salt such as ammonium sulfate. Urea can be administered together with urea phosphate. The composition provides a slow release form of urea that avoids inducing ammonia toxicity in the animal and is water soluble for administration to the animal in drinking water.
